Cassandra is a 3D viewer and data analysis tools for 3d data set, based on VTK and Java (see: http://www.artenum.com/FR/Produits-Cassandra.html) and JSynoptic is a 2D y=f(x) plotter (like Xmgrace) and based on JFreeChart (see: http://jsynoptic.sourceforge.net/).Ju.
